Coach Klein says: "Nigel possesses an enormous serve and strong volleys, while his ground game is getting much better. He has made himself into a better athlete since he's been here and just keeps getting better on the court."

2004-05: Played in one doubles match during the spring campaign, a loss against Southern. Played in five fall singles matches as a freshman. Picked up his first collegiate victory with a win at the Ragin' Cajun Classic.

Prep: A native of San José, Costa Rica, attended Country Day School in Florida, graduating in June of 2004. Ranked No. 1 in his country in his age group in singles. Became the first Costa Rican to win an ITF tournament on native soil (Copa Cariari doubles, June 2003). Reached the quarterfinals of five ITF Tournaments throughout the Caribbean. Achieved a 906 junior ranking in singles and a 288 ranking in doubles.

Personal: Born September 11, 1985 in San José, Costa Rica. The son of Kim Barton and Catherine Kayser. Father played football at the University of Toronto. Intends to major in finance or economics.
